Output 462e37f1af6bdab33c3db0b8eb8f6cdfa81c61d4f8b7a11b0a39c639401bbf98:1

value
12352433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 945aedaa42b26e3e62af7e3a60b49cd68d7709f3 OP_EQUAL
address
MMRbAdpY4wvr454WLkz6KiU4nBsNApN7A6
transaction
462e37f1af6bdab33c3db0b8eb8f6cdfa81c61d4f8b7a11b0a39c639401bbf98
spent
true